Securing Japanese Work Permits
Securing a job in Japan requires careful planning and a firm grasp of the visa process. Generally, most foreigners will need a sponsored visa to legally engage in labor in the country. These are often tied to a specific occupation and company, and the requirements can vary considerably based on the category of job. Popular immigration types include the Engineer/Specialist in Humanities/International here Services authorization, the Instructor permit, and the Skilled Labor permit, each with its own specific requirement standards. It’s essential to meticulously investigate the detailed rules applicable to your field and to obtain the necessary documentation beforehand. Moreover, employers typically play a major function in the work permit request process, so finding a cooperative local is often essential to a favorable outcome. Think about consulting with an specialized attorney for customized guidance.
